+/* cat -- concatenate files and print on the standard output.
+ Copyright (C) 1988, 1990, 1991 Free Software Foundation, Inc.
+
+ This program is free software; you can redistribute it and/or modify
+ it under the terms of the GNU General Public License as published by
+ the Free Software Foundation; either version 2, or (at your option)
+ any later version.
+
+ This program is distributed in the hope that it will be useful,
+ but WITHOUT ANY WARRANTY; without even the implied warranty of
+ M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
+ GNU General Public License for more details.
+
+ You should have received a copy of the GNU General Public License
+ along with this program; if not, write to the Free Software
+ Foundation, Inc., 675 Mass Ave, Cambridge, MA 02139, USA. */
+
+/* Differences from the Unix cat:
+ * Always unbuffered, -u is ignored.
+ * 100 times faster with -v -u.
+ * 20 times faster with -v.
+
+ By tege@sics.se, Torbjorn Granlund, advised by rms, Richard Stallman. */

+ /* Select which version of `cat' to use. If any options (more than -u)
+ were specified, use `cat', otherwise use `simple_cat'. */
+
+ if (options == 0)
+ {
+ insize = max (insize, outsize);
+ inbuf = (unsigned char *) xmalloc (insize);
+
+ simple_cat (inbuf, insize);
+ }
+ else
+ {
+ inbuf = (unsigned char *) xmalloc (insize + 1);
+
+ /* Why are (OUTSIZE - 1 + INSIZE * 4 + 13) bytes allocated for
+ the output buffer?
+
+ A test whether output needs to be written is done when the input
+ buffer empties or when a newline appears in the input. After
+ output is written, at most (OUTSIZE - 1) bytes will remain in the
+ buffer. Now INSIZE bytes of input is read. Each input character
+ may grow by a factor of 4 (by the prepending of M-^). If all
+ characters do, and no newlines appear in this block of input, we
+ will have at most (OUTSIZE - 1 + INSIZE) bytes in the buffer. If
+ the last character in the preceeding block of input was a
+ newline, a line number may be written (according to the given
+ options) as the first thing in the output buffer. (Done after the
+ new input is read, but before processing of the input begins.) A
+ line number requires seldom more than 13 positions. */
+
+ outbuf = (unsigned char *) xmalloc (outsize - 1 + insize * 4 + 13);
+
+ cat (inbuf, insize, outbuf, outsize, quote,
+ output_tabs, numbers, numbers_at_empty_lines, mark_line_ends,
+ squeeze_empty_lines);
+
+ free (outbuf);
+ }

+/* Plain cat. Copies the file behind `input_desc' to the file behind
+ `output_desc'. */
+
+void
+simple_cat (buf, bufsize)
+ /* Pointer to the buffer, used by reads and writes. */
+ unsigned char *buf;
+
+ /* Number of characters preferably read or written by each read and write
+ call. */
+ int bufsize;
+{
+ /* Actual number of characters read, and therefore written. */
+ int n_read;
+
+ /* Loop until the end of the file. */
+
+ for (;;)
+ {
+ /* Read a block of input. */
+
+ n_read = read (input_desc, buf, bufsize);
+ if (n_read < 0)
+ {
+ error (0, errno, "%s", infile);
+ exit_stat = 1;
+ return;
+ }
+
+ /* End of this file? */
+
+ if (n_read == 0)
+ break;
+
+ /* Write this block out. */
+
+ if (write (output_desc, buf, n_read) != n_read)
+ error (1, errno, "write error");
+ }
+}
